From a443e09748a87025a493b02569e67e65861b4a1e Mon Sep 17 00:00:00 2001 From: Andre Ramnitz Date: Mon, 3 Feb 2025 06:40:32 +0100 Subject: [PATCH] local: waybar script - initial support for two displays --- dot-local/bin/wb |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/dot-local/bin/wb b/dot-local/bin/wb index ed6ddcb2..7690f28c 100755 --- a/dot-local/bin/wb +++ b/dot-local/bin/wb @@ -1,26 +1,30 @@ #!/bin/bash reload() { - local CONFIG="$HOME/.config/waybar/config.jsonc" + local CONFIGLEFT="$HOME/.config/waybar/config.jsonc" + local CONFIGRIGHT="$HOME/.config/waybar/config-dp2.jsonc" local STYLE="$HOME/.config//waybar/style.css" if [ "$(pidof waybar)" ]; then kill -SIGUSR2 "$(pidof waybar)" else - waybar -c "$CONFIG" -s "$STYLE" > /dev/null 2>&1 & + waybar -c "$CONFIGLEFT" -s "$STYLE" > /dev/null 2>&1 & + # waybar -c "$CONFIGRIGHT" -s "$STYLE" > /dev/null 2>&1 & fi } hide() { - local CONFIG="$HOME/.config/waybar/config.jsonc" + local CONFIGLEFT="$HOME/.config/waybar/config.jsonc" + local CONFIGRIGHT="$HOME/.config/waybar/config-dp2.jsonc" local STYLE="$HOME/.config//waybar/style.css" if [ "$(pidof waybar)" ]; then kill -SIGUSR1 "$(pidof waybar)" else - waybar -c "$CONFIG" -s "$STYLE" > /dev/null 2>&1 & + waybar -c "$CONFIGLEFT" -s "$STYLE" > /dev/null 2>&1 & + # waybar -c "$CONFIGRIGHT" -s "$STYLE" > /dev/null 2>&1 & fi } -- 2.51.2